1. Can You Fix Wood Scratches Without Sanding?

Yes—most surface scratches and minor damage can be repaired without sanding.

Sanding is usually only needed for:

  • Deep structural damage
  • Large surface refinishing
  • Severe discoloration

For everyday scratches, non-sanding repair methods are faster, easier, and safer for your furniture.

2. Types of Wood Scratches (And How to Identify Them)

Before fixing the damage, it’s important to understand what you’re dealing with:

1). Light Surface Scratches

  • Only affect the top finish
  • Usually caused by daily use
  • Easy to fix with touch-up markers

2). Medium Scratches

  • Slightly deeper, visible lines
  • May need fillers + color blending

3). Deep Scratches or Chips

  • Expose raw wood underneath
  • Require filling and smoothing

3. 5 Easy Ways to Fix Scratched Wood Furniture

1). Use a Wood Touch-Up Marker

Best for light scratches.

  • Choose a color close to your furniture
  • Gently draw over the scratch
  • Wipe off excess for a natural look

👉 Quick, clean, and beginner-friendly

2). Apply Wood Filler for Deeper Damage

Best for cracks, chips, and holes.

  • Apply filler into the damaged area
  • Smooth with a scraper
  • Let it dry before finishing

3). Blend Colors for a Perfect Match

Wood rarely has a single tone.

Mixing colors helps:

  • Match natural wood grain
  • Avoid obvious patch marks
  • Achieve a seamless repair

4). Restore Wood Grain Details

Use fine-tip markers to recreate grain lines.

This step:

  • Makes repairs look more natural
  • Improves overall finish
  • Adds a professional touch

Common Mistakes to Avoid:

  • ❌ Using the wrong color
  • ❌ Applying too much filler at once
  • ❌ Skipping drying time
  • ❌ Not blending the repair area

Taking a few extra minutes can make a big difference in the final result.
